TRIM zachraňuje SSD A-Data a Intel

9. 12. 2009

Sdílet

 Autor: Redakce

Výkon nového SSD nemusí být stejný jako výkon používaného SSD. To všechno proto, že si řadič SSD nerozumí s operačním systémem, nekoordinuje s ním svoje kroky. Zatímco SSD potřebuje, aby do prázdných bloků byly vepsány nuly, operačním systém při mazání pouze označí oblast za smazanou. To je rychlejší, jenže pro flashový SSD, který čte po stránkách a dokáže zapisovat jen ve větších blocích určité velikosti to znamená, že do takového bloku nemůže jen zapsat, ale musí přečíst, modifikovat a poté teprve zapsat.

V praxi to znamená, že SSD po nějakém čase používání může výrazně zpomalit, zejména pokud dojde na zápis do už jednou vymazaných oblastí. Jak problematický může výkon SSD být, ukazuje třeba nedávný duel Intel X25-M (34 nm, G2) proti OCZ Agility (Indilinx Barefoot).

Aby nebyl výkon SSD po čase používání zazděn, začala být vyvíjena funkce (či příkaz, chcete-li) TRIM. S ní se začalo v Linuxu 2.6.28, ale alespoň podle Wikipedie zde nebyla dosud dotažena. Prvním operačním systémem s podporou TRIM se tak stala Windows 7 od Microsoftu. Podmínkou pro správnou funkci TRIM je použití ovladače přímo od Microsoftu (pciide.sys či lépe msahci.sys), různé ovladače k polím RAID (včetně Intel Matrix) a dalším řadičům tudíž nemůžete použít (nestarání se o problém je například ze strany Intelu opravdu nechvályhodné)

Intel v listopadu každopádně vydal nový firmware pro svoje 34nm SSD (G2 či Postville), který má jak podporu TRIM, tak už by se neměl vracet k předchozím problémům. Navíc u 160GB X25-M G2 zvyšuje rychlost zápisu (sekvenčně) až na 100 MB/s. Update firmwaru učiníte pomocí stažení ISO ze stránek Intelu, vypálení na CD, startu z CD a provedení přehrání Aby uživatelé Windows Vista a XP nepřišli zkrátka, mohou TRIM vyvolat pomocí prográmku Intel SSD Toolbox.

Ten však kvůli dalšímu problému se ztrátou bodů obnovení (či něco takového, už jsem se při řešení problémů s SSD začal trochu ztrácet) momentálně stáhl ze svých stránek a to ještě nejhloupějším způsobem: vše ponechal, smazal z HTML jen tlačíko Download (a uživatel hledá, kliká tam a zpátky, ...). Přes google lze naštěstí na jakési obdobě rapidsharu SSD Toolbox ještě najít (než Intel znovu vystaví opravenou verzi).

Dnes nám zaslala e-mailem šťastnou novinku i A-Data, že nově dodávané SSD S592 (viz recenze tohoto povedeného SSD s Indilinx Barefoot) a SX96 (SX95, firmware stáhnete z odkazu dodaného naším čtenářem) už mají také firmware s podporou TRIM.

A-Data SSD

Na stránkách A-Data jsem se k novému (snad je 1848 právě on) firmwaru proklikal jen pro model S592, vlastníkům snad ušetří práci překopírovaná tabulka s přímými odkazy ke stažení.

ICTS24

Model Type Describe File size Download
SSD S592 SATAII FWupdate_1848_128G 111KB
SSD S592 SATAII FWupdate_1848_64G 111KB
SSD S592 SATAII FWupdate_1848_32G 111KB
SSD S592 SATAII FWupfate_1571_128GB 112KB
SSD S592 SATAII FWupfate_1571_64GB 112KB
SSD S592 SATAII FWupfate_1571_32GB 112KB
Manual
Model Type Describe File size Download
SSD S592 SATAII FWupdate_Guide 253KB

 

Uživatelé jiných systémů než Windows 7 a jiných SSD s Indilinx Barefoot se už delší dobu mohou bránit proti zazdění výkonu pomocí utility Wiper. Wiper.exe sice nevyvolá TRIM a OS tak neřekne SSD, které bloky se už dále nepoužívají, ale alespoň pročistí prázdné místo (stejný účinek má i plné/pomalé formátování partition, zde ale přijdete o všechna data, nejen informace ve smazaných oblastech). Netřeba asi dodávat, že klasická defragmentace je pro SSD k ničemu.

Autor článku